Summary
Abstract: The NSF-supported research icebreaker Nathaniel B. Palmer operates year-round in support of the U.S. Antarctic Program, carrying out global change studies in biological, chemical, physical, and oceanographic disciplines.

This data set consists of underway data from leg NBP0302 on the R/V Nathaniel B. Palmer. This leg started at McMurdo/Ice Edge and ended at McMurdo/Ice Edge.
